Clair Volkwyn: Home energy management and the smart home has the potential to have a substantial impact on utilities. What results have your partner utilities seen and how have consumers been impacted?

Manoj Kumar: What we have done with Powerley is unlock that AMI data for the customer. So now through our solution, which basically becomes an extension of the AMI meter itself, customers can see in real-time how much energy they are consuming. Here, the customer value proposition from the AMI meter comes into play. What this does for the utility is it gives them a deeper engagement with the customer besides bill pay and outage which can be negative experiences. Now they are able to see customer enjoy interacting with the energy they are consuming. The [energy efficiency and customer engagement] result we are seeing are substantial.
